The collection includes works by over fifty women from different generations, active from the mid-1960s. The sudden changes and feminist protests of this time in fact encouraged the appearance of great numbers of women photographers, photojournalists and artists on the Italian cultural scene, which had hitherto been dominated by men.
The main themes emerging from these works are the centrality of the body and its transformations, the need to give voice to personal experience and everyday and family life, the relationship between private and collective memory: these fundamental topics weave a thread linking together images which otherwise belong to different times and genres, from photojournalism to experimental photography.w
